The Significance of Names and Hope in Genesis
This chapter explores the biblical significance of the names Cain and Seth, emphasizing Eve's initial hopes for redemption through her firstborn. It unravels the ongoing conflict between good and evil as the narrative unfolds, reflecting the enduring faith in God's promise of salvation.
